dc.description.abstractThe automotive parts manufacturing business has continuously increased market competition. The production costs are always discussed when negotiating prices. (The price of the product is often taken into account in always negotiating with customers) Therefore, manufacturers focus on continuously reducing production costs. To maintain reasonable profits in this research, a method to reduce costs by creating an automation system to replace manual labor in the wheel packaging workstation is presented. Because human labor is one of the main costs in the cost of producing goods. This research was carried out in a wheel assembly plant in the TFD Industrial Estate and after the implementation an automation system for wheel arranging. The company can reduce production costs by reducing the number of employees in the workstation packing for 3 people and can reduce production costs by 522,000 baht per year and increase productivity by 127.84% as well.
